Sustainability throughout the entire end-to-end supply chain So what kind of impact does this new advisory group make for their clients? ‘Our team helps businesses to market their new products faster. But we can also support product management during its lifecycle. In other words, we help our clients deliver value in the most sustainable way’, Geert explains. Renate adds: ‘In fact, we support the entire end-to-end supply chain, from product launch to the end of the product cycle.’ ‘Or even one step further – the end of its lifecycle’, Geert continues, who is also Technology, Media & Telecommunications (TMT) Consulting Sustainability Lead. ‘During product development, 80 per cent of the sustainability of a product is being determined. So if you want to make an impact, you focus on the start of the life cycle! We can also help our clients with that. Clients recognize the need to leverage digital technology to innovate, collaborate, and launch new products, where at the same time being sustainable. You see that sustainability really is a hot topic – both at Deloitte and at our large clients.’

Digital twin ‘In order to help our clients in their journey, we often adopt innovative technologies’, Geert says. ‘Digital technologies offer huge opportunities. If you want to make digital copies of products, for instance to predict their sustainability, the opportunities are endless.’ Renate agrees: ‘You can build a digital twin of a product in order to optimise its performance through the entire chain. Naturally, marketing a new product involves a number of risks. A simulation makes the process much more transparent, which is a huge advantage.’ ‘For instance, we ran a digital test of a prototype for a manufacturer of car tyre wires’, Geert says. ‘Usually, we would have to shut down the entire site in order to test a new product. This new solution saves our clients a large amount of money and materials. It energises me to achieve outstanding results for our clients, together with our motivated colleagues.
